Definition of ern

Thanks for using this online dictionary, we have been helping millions of people improve their use of the english language with its free online services. English definition of ern is as below...

Ern (v. i.) To stir with strong emotion; to grieve; to mourn. [Corrupted into yearn in modern editions of Shakespeare..
